Article Overview

This article presents a 2001 Medicare physician fee schedule final rule and its addenda. It discusses selected payment policy clarifications, budget-neutrality considerations, and how the annual fee schedule tables are organized for CPT and HCPCS services, including status indicators, modifiers, RVUs, and global period information. It is intended for coders, billing staff, compliance teams, and others who work with Medicare physician payment rules and fee schedule references.

Article Sections

  1. Ocular Photodynamic Therapy and Other Ophthalmological Treatments

    Discusses Medicare payment policy and national coding activity for ophthalmology-related services.

  2. Electrical Bioimpedance

    Addresses national pricing for a covered service and its budgetary effect within the Medicare program.

  3. Global Period for Insertion, Removal, and Replacement of Pacemakers and Cardioverter Defibrillators

    Describes proposed and final considerations related to global period policy for certain cardiology procedures.

  4. Antigen Supply

    Covers a change involving the allowable supply period for antigen billing under Medicare Part B.

  5. Increased Space Allotment in Physical Therapy Salary Equivalency Guidelines

    Addresses an adjustment affecting practice expense calculations for therapy services.

  6. Budget-Neutrality

    Summarizes the annual budget-neutrality framework used for physician fee schedule updates.

  7. Impact on Beneficiaries

    Discusses the rule’s general implications for access to care and beneficiary experience.

  8. Federalism

    Notes the rule’s review under federalism criteria and its effect on state roles and responsibilities.

  9. Part 410 and Part 414 Regulatory Amendments

    Lists the regulatory sections revised in the final rule and the related Medicare program authorities.

  10. Addendum A -- Explanation and Use of Addenda B

    Introduces the annual fee schedule addenda and explains how the payment tables are organized.

  11. Addendum B—2001 Relative Value Units and Related Information Used in Determining Medicare Payments for 2001

    Explains the data elements included in the yearly CPT and HCPCS payment reference tables and the meaning of their indicators.
